enlightening. not for immovable minds.  (2003-06-03)
A book by the legal genius who handled the appeal of the case. . . who incidentally was later part of OJ Simpson's defence team.

The particulars of the Von Bulow case form only half of the pleasures of this book. After all, regardless of our personal opinions of the guilt or innocence of the man, there is the separate and superior question of legal procedure (which must further be distinguished from "technicalities"). Which is precisely why we have LEGAL SYSTEMS, in addition to, separate from, and taking precedence over OPINION POLLS. In fact, it is precisely the complexities of the case which make it exciting--each side having grounds to support its own arguments.

The other pleasure is in beholding Dershowitz's brilliance--ironically enough, manifested not through masterful manipulation of mind-bogglingly complex legal theories and procedures, but by taking a fresh and plain look at each mundane part of the case (any case; the same approach he uses in each of his cases, including later the Simpson case), and find inadequacies in the prosecution's arguments. And it is precisely this which convinces an OBJECTIVE mind to recognise that it is the contradictions that Dershowitz's team of assistants and students pointed out, having remained unexplained and unrefuted, which inevitably led to acquittal on appeal. (Thus, "reversal of fortune".)

It is such OBJECTIVITY with PLAIN MATTERS (say, syringe needles implausibly said to contain traces) that is impressively displayed. Enabling both the winning defender to have solid GROUNDS for his victory, and the losing opponent to have equally-IRREFUTABLE reasons for his failure this time (lessons of which, if applied, should reduce future defeats).

It is this that we learn from the book, or whenever Prof Dershowitz speaks. Which is a bonus, for the Von Bulow is an engaging legal thriller by itself, too.
